The Director of National Parks (the Director) is responsible for six national parks, the Australian National Botanic Gardens, 58 Australian Marine Parks and the Heard Island and McDonald Islands Marine Reserve established under the Environment Protection and Biodiversity Conservation Act 1999. Parks Australia is the federal park agency that supports the Director, and they are a division of the Department of Climate Change, Energy, the Environment and Water (the Department). Norfolk Island National Park (NINP) covers 650 ha: 460 ha on Norfolk Island and 190 ha on the nearby Phillip Island. NINP covers approximately 19% of the land mass of Norfolk Island and is home to a diverse range of flora and fauna. Norfolk Marine Park (NMP), surrounding Norfolk Island, supports diverse temperate and tropical marine life. Together, NINP and NMP are major tourist destinations for the island, and an important community resource both economically and culturally.
